Emmerdale is no stranger to last-minute wedding drama, and this time the groom himself is the source of the chaos. With a web of lies tightening around him, John Sugden seems ready to take desperate measures to protect the truthājust as heās meant to be saying “I do.” But secrets have a nasty habit of surfacing in the worst possible moments, and Emmerdale fans are in for a nail-biting twist.
For weeks, John has been living with a dark secretāheās responsible for the death of Nate Robinson. While the villagers believe Nate simply vanished to start a new life, viewers know the grim reality: Nateās body lies undiscovered at the bottom of a lake, and John is the one who put him there. His calm exterior masks a man teetering on the edge, doing everything he can to maintain the illusion of innocence.

Now, as John prepares to marry, pressure mounts. The guilt over his deadly actions has been slowly eroding his confidence, but itās the increasing risk of exposure that truly rattles him. With the Dingles beginning to doubt the narrative around Nate’s disappearance, John’s worst fear is coming true: suspicion is creeping in.
As wedding day approaches, John starts acting more erratically. Despite appearances of calm planning and excitement, there are signs something is very wrong. He isolates himself, avoids meaningful conversations, and becomes hyper-focused on controlling every detail of the dayāespecially who will be present and what might be said.
Behind the scenes, John begins preparing for an escape. Itās not just cold feet; itās self-preservation. He knows that if anyone uncovers the truth before the wedding, everything will unravelāhis relationship, his reputation, and potentially his freedom.
But what he doesnāt realize is that cracks are already showing. Belle Dingle, freshly returned from her rushed and suspicious trip to Shetland (where she confirmed Nate never went), is starting to piece together inconsistencies. Her instincts tell her somethingās off, and while she hasnāt yet connected all the dots, sheās watching John closely. Others, too, are beginning to whisper. Tracyās ongoing grief and confusion over Nateās silence donāt match the picture John tries to paint. The tension in the village is palpable.
In a particularly dramatic pre-wedding scene, John is seen secretly removing cash and a passport from a hidden compartment, suggesting heās not planning a honeymoon but a getaway. As he stares at his reflection, doubt clouds his faceāthis isnāt just a wedding jitters moment. Itās the prelude to a flight from justice.
Meanwhile, his bride-to-be remains blissfully unaware. Sheās busy with final preparations, convinced sheās on the cusp of a new beginning with a man she believes she knows and loves. But that illusion is fragile and could be shattered at any moment. And that moment might come from an unexpected source.
At the wedding venue, with guests arriving and emotions high, John hesitates. Every glance feels like an accusation, every question a potential exposure. Then, just before the ceremony begins, he vanishes. Panic sets in. Where is John? Is he just nervousāor is he gone for good?
The villagers scramble to find him, unaware of the real reason for his disappearance. What starts as a presumed runaway groom storyline quickly turns into something far more sinister when Belle shares what sheās uncovered. Her suspicions, combined with John’s sudden absence, shift the tone from heartbreak to alarm.
As the episode ends, viewers are left with a haunting image: an abandoned wedding venue, a devastated bride, and a growing suspicion that one of Emmerdaleās most trusted faces is hiding a deadly secret.
This shocking twist isnāt just a disruption to wedding plansāitās a turning point in the showās narrative. With John on the run and Nateās body still undiscovered, the village is on the brink of uncovering a crime that will rock it to its core. And if John does manage to flee, the manhunt for him could become one of the most gripping story arcs Emmerdale has delivered in recent years.
One thing is clear: the truth always finds a way out. And John Sugdenās carefully constructed life is about to come crashing downāveil, vows, and all.
